Gary G.

My favorite donut shop in MetroWest is sort of a cross between a pop-up and a rented sub-space within the Vin Bin, but they're here to stay. These are mostly brioche donuts, so not that sweet and more bready, but the freshness separates them from other contenders (pretenders) whose donuts feel more like hamburger buns. Here, they're usually fluffy. The real star is the toppings and fillings, which are always made with quality ingredients and often brilliant. But back to the freshness: one drawback for some is that not all of the posted varieties are available 100% of the time, but that means they're making new batches throughout the morning.Classic Vanilla Bean Glazed: Great showcase for the underlying donut quality, which is voluminous but usually fluffy and light. The topping is very liberally applied, very natural tasting, and not just sugar. No flaking; taste and texture more like delicious buttercream. Boston Cream: Same basic donut, filled with fairly ordinary vanilla pudding but topped with extraordinary chocolate ganache. Thick, dark, moist, and intense. Probably a bit behind Union Square Donuts in topping intensity/quality, but with an underlying donut that's fresher and superior to USD. Belgian Chocolate Ganache: Same deal as Boston Cream, only with a hole instead of filling. Go with whichever looks more recently arrived.Jelly: These come in a variety of configurations at different times, but with two things in common: always spherical and plump, and always filled extra generously with the jelly of choice. These aren't the kind that takes you three or four bites to strike jelly; it's an explosion from the get-go.Scones: Different flavors available different weeks. Crusty on the outside, dense but moist on the inside, and good filling content, whether fruit or chocolate. Like a thick, thick cookie. A chocolate chip one was very gooey without stooping to lowest common denominator theatrics. Excellent.Apple Fritter: Big, bumpy, fluffy, fresh, warm, and extra glazy. Filling more like standard issue apple sauce, so no excitement there, but what an exterior and texture. Sometimes they do them with caramel, but I like the simplicity of the regular ones better. You decide.Coffee: They have it, but it's not really a priority. Sometimes at opening it's not ready. Silver lining: ready or not, you can bring Starbucks in from next door.
